Setting Up User Accounts

4.6.1

System Administration, Passwords, and Privilege Levels

In a plant with many users with various levels of training and responsibility, it is often
desirable to restrict certain users access to a limited range of functions. Starting the
ValveNavi program requires a valid account with a user name and a password for each
user. The privilege level associated with a ValveNavi account determines which functions
of the program the user is allowed to access.

The ValveNavi Administration program allows the administrator to perform all user account
administrative functions to run ValveNavi and to control access to the functionality of the
YVP positioner.

These administrative functions include:

Adding new user accounts

Deleting existing user accounts

Changing existing user accounts

Adjusting privilege levels

4.6.2

Start the Administration Program

After installation of ValveNavi, the ValveNavi administrator should change the default
passwords, set up the initial user accounts through the Admin program, and secure the
setup disk. Anyone with access to the setup disk could reload the software and thereby get
access to YVP devices.

To start ValveNavi Admininistration, select Start->Program->ValveNavi->ValveNavi
Admininistration. The administrative program prompts you for a logon name and password.
Log in for the first time with an administrator account. Enter the default logon name
(“Admin”) and leave password blank. (Note: The system is case sensitive, and you must
type the default names in correct case.) Then, clicking OK to open the VFAdmin dialog
(Figure 4.5).
